Joseph Goldberg 1937-2023

LOS ANGELES — Joseph “Joe” Goldberg, 85, passed away in West Hills, Calif., on Friday, March 24, 2023. He was born in Youngstown on June 26, 1937, graduated from The Rayen School in 1955 and attended Youngstown State University. He was the son of Benjamin and Mary Elizabeth Goldberg and grew up on the North Side of Youngstown with brothers Irving, Norman and Meyer.

Joe went on to start his career as a general contractor and real estate broker. In his first year, he bought and refurbished over 100 properties from HUD, and went on to buy and manage commercial and multifamily properties throughout the Youngstown area. Joe created one of the first home warranty protection plans, marketed through real estate brokers. He served as president of the Youngstown Area Board of Realtors and was named “Realtor of the Year,” vice president of the Better Business Bureau, president of the Northside Kiwanis Club, and active in the Mahoning Valley Chamber of Commerce.

Joe relocated his family to Bell Canyon, Calif., in 1978 and was vice president of Standard Planning Corporation, a national insurance marketing company with over 5,000 licensed agents. Joe was a real estate broker in California since 1982, listing and selling hundreds of businesses, and was with Sunbelt Business Brokers from 2000 to 2022, when he retired. He was a member of the International Business Brokers Association, California Business Brokers Association, as well as a member of the National Association of Realtors.

Joe leaves his wife of 54 years, Lee Goldberg of Bell Canyon, Calif.; daughters, Davene Peruzzini of Scottsdale, Ariz. and Liane Goldberg of Bell Canyon, Calif.; brother, Irving Goldberg of Encino, Calif.; granddaughter, Nicole (Chad) Marston of Phoenix, Ariz.; and nieces, nephews and lifelong friends. All will miss his jovial and fun personality, and love of family and friends.
